For better or worse, the 16:9 rectangle is losing to the 9:16 vertical square. Gen Z consumes media primarily on phones, held vertically. Major studios are now shooting "vertical" versions of their movies for TikTok and YouTube Shorts. In five years, the idea of rotating your phone to watch a "horizontal movie" might feel as archaic as turning a crank on a kinetoscope.
The most successful modern creators aren't abandoning legacy media; they are hybridizing it. Emma Chamberlain walked the Met Gala carpet after becoming a YouTube sensation. Quinta Brunson turned her online comedy sketches into the Emmy-winning Abbott Elementary . MrBeast turned YouTube stunts into a massive food brand (Feastables) and a reality competition on Amazon. The pipeline from "influencer" to "mainstream star" is now a superhighway.
